Transaction e6d56e223581d76354230f1ac933ae46ece99a0b6fa82fa5721e6c9238319a0f
1 Input
1 Outputs
- e6d56e223581d76354230f1ac933ae46ece99a0b6fa82fa5721e6c9238319a0f:0
value 766743
address 34xp2avj7bmK1o4tPxwmSWEo4zFGrNXqgq